IRA Newsletter Project: Effective Literacy Website #7

             Storyline Online (https://www.storylineonline.net/) is a collection of video recordings of children's stories being read by notable actors and actresses. Each video has a short introduction by the actor before transitioning to the reading of the story. Students can follow along with the pictures and words of each story. Along with each video you will find a set of online and offline activities to support your use of each story in your classroom.
Storyline Online could be a nice resource for elementary school classrooms. The videos are short and easy to follow. If you're looking for some nice reading activities for students to do at home with their parents, Storyline Online could be good for that too.
Reading aloud to children has been shown to improve reading, writing and communication skills, logical thinking and concentration, and general academic skill, as well as inspire a lifelong love of reading. Storyline Online is available 24 hours a day for children, parents, caregivers and educators worldwide. Each book includes supplemental curriculum developed by elementary educators, aiming to strengthen comprehension and verbal and written skills for English-language learners. Storyline Online is a program of the SAG-AFTRA Foundation. The Foundation is a nonprofit organization that relies entirely on gifts, grants and donations to fund Storyline Online and produce all of its videos.
